uv inkjet printers

UV inkjet printers represent a cutting-edge advancement in digital printing technology, offering unparalleled versatility and exceptional print quality across diverse materials. These sophisticated printing systems utilize ultraviolet light to instantly cure specialized inks, enabling immediate handling of printed items without waiting for drying time. The technology employs precision printheads that deliver microscopic ink droplets, achieving remarkable detail and color accuracy on substrates ranging from traditional paper to glass, metal, plastic, and wood. Modern UV inkjet printers integrate advanced features such as automatic height adjustment, intelligent temperature control, and variable dot printing capabilities, ensuring consistent output quality regardless of material thickness or surface characteristics. The printing process involves UV-LED lamps that emit specific wavelengths of ultraviolet light, instantly transforming liquid ink into a solid state through photopolymerization. This innovative approach not only ensures superior durability but also enables printing on heat-sensitive materials without substrate deformation. Professional-grade UV inkjet printers typically feature multiple ink channels, including CMYK, white, and varnish options, allowing for enhanced creativity and specialized finishing effects. The technology's ability to print directly on three-dimensional objects has revolutionized product customization and industrial marking applications.

UV inkjet printers offer numerous compelling advantages that make them an invaluable investment for businesses across various sectors. First and foremost, their instant curing capability significantly accelerates production workflows, eliminating traditional drying times and enabling immediate post-print processing. This feature not only boosts productivity but also prevents common issues like color bleeding or smudging. The versatility of UV printing technology allows businesses to expand their service offerings by accommodating an extensive range of substrates, from flexible materials to rigid surfaces, without compromising print quality. Environmental considerations are another significant advantage, as UV inks produce minimal volatile organic compounds (VOCs) and require no special ventilation systems, making them safer for operator health and workplace environments. The durability of UV-cured prints is exceptional, offering superior resistance to scratching, fading, and chemical exposure, which extends the lifespan of printed products and reduces the need for additional protective coatings. Cost-effectiveness is achieved through reduced ink waste, as UV inks don't evaporate or dry in the printheads during operation. The ability to print white ink and varnish in a single pass enables creative effects and premium finishing options that were previously difficult or impossible to achieve with conventional printing methods. Furthermore, UV inkjet technology offers precise dot placement and exceptional color consistency, ensuring high-quality results across long print runs. The technology's digital nature allows for variable data printing and quick job changes without the setup costs associated with traditional printing methods.

Superior Print Quality and Resolution

Superior Print Quality and Resolution

UV inkjet printers excel in delivering exceptional print quality through advanced droplet control technology and precise dot placement systems. The integration of variable dot printing capabilities allows these machines to produce ultra-fine gradients and smooth color transitions, achieving photographic quality even at close viewing distances. Modern UV printers typically offer resolutions up to 1440 dpi or higher, ensuring crisp text reproduction and sharp image details. The instant curing process prevents ink dot gain and bleeding, maintaining edge definition and color accuracy throughout the print run. This level of quality control is particularly valuable for applications requiring fine detail reproduction, such as art reproductions, retail displays, and premium packaging materials.
Innovative Material Compatibility

Innovative Material Compatibility

One of the most remarkable features of UV inkjet printers is their unprecedented material compatibility. These systems can effectively print on virtually any flat or curved surface, including glass, acrylic, metal, wood, leather, fabric, and various plastics. The UV curing process ensures excellent adhesion across these diverse substrates without the need for special pre-treatments in many cases. This versatility is achieved through sophisticated height adjustment mechanisms and ink formulations specifically designed for different material properties. The ability to print on materials up to several inches thick opens up new possibilities for architectural elements, interior décor, and industrial applications.
Advanced Workflow Automation

Advanced Workflow Automation

Modern UV inkjet printers incorporate sophisticated automation features that streamline production processes and enhance operational efficiency. Intelligent sensor systems automatically detect substrate thickness and adjust printhead height accordingly, minimizing setup time and reducing the risk of head strikes. Advanced media handling systems ensure precise material positioning and movement throughout the printing process. Many systems include automated maintenance routines that perform printhead cleaning and capping operations, extending component life and maintaining consistent print quality. The integration of powerful RIP software enables efficient job processing, color management, and production scheduling, while built-in quality control features monitor print parameters in real-time to ensure consistent output quality.
